Genetic News
by T.M. D'Souza, W. Kalle, A.W.I. Lo, R.V. Nemade, U. Sattler, F.S. Zollmann
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en
- Harnessing The Activity Of A Detox Enzyme
Researchers have determined the structure of an enzyme that inactivates
the nerve agent sarin and related toxic molecules.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g22.html
- Noticing The Mistakes Of Others
The same brain region is active both when people make errors and when
they watch other people making errors.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g21.html
- Tan, Then Transplant
A dose of ultraviolet (UV) radiation staves off graft vs. host disease
(GVHD) after a bone marrow transplant.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g20.html
- Suppressing The Bad
Autoimmunity is normally prevented in most people, possibly because of a
population of CD8 suppressor cells, whose existence has now been proven
by scientists.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g19.html
- A New Mode For Killing Cancer Cells
The p53 protein performs a more direct role in cell suicide (apoptosis)
by interacting with one of the pro-death proteins.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g18.html
- HIV/Polio Vaccine Theory Refuted
The data should help to end speculation that the immunodeficiency virus
jumped to humans after polio vaccines became contaminated with a simian
form of the virus.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g17.html
- No Need For Men?
Researchers have produced live mice by parthenogenesis, in which the
unfertilized egg retains two sets of chromosomes and begins to develop
as if it had been fertilized.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g16.html
- World’s oldest mouse reaches milestone birthday
U-M’s geriatric mouse colony helps scientists learn about human aging.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g15.html
- When 'Switched On' Muscle Stem Cells Morph To Resemble Nerve Cells
An artificial gene activates a panel of genes that are normally silent
in the muscle cells, causing them to morph into neuronal cells.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g14.html
- A New Hypothesis About Autoimmunity—Is it Possible to be Too Clean?
Connection between poor T cell survival in the body and the development
of autoimmunity.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g13.html
- New Hereditary Gene Linked To Parkinson's Disease
UCL scientists have discovered a new gene implicated in the early
development of Parkinson's disease.
http://hum-molgen.org/NewsGen/04-2004/msg12.html
- Rewriting Textbooks On DNA Crossover
Key decisions in the genetic shuffling that occurs before eggs or sperm
are formed are made earlier than thought.
